How to Make Easy Peanut Butter Bars
Step 1: Prepare the Peanut Butter Mixture
Start by softening butter in a mixing bowl, then add the peanut butter and vanilla extract. Stir until smooth and creamy, ensuring everything is well combined for the best texture.
Step 2: Incorporate the Powdered Sugar
Gradually mix in the powdered sugar. Use a spatula or wooden spoon to combine, pressing firmly to create a thick, dough-like consistency. This mixture should become pliable but not crumbly.
Step 3: Add Optional Mix-Ins
If you want extra flavor or texture, now’s the time to fold in chocolate chips, nuts, or crunchy cereal. These additions make each bite a little more exciting.
Step 4: Press Into a Pan
Line a square baking dish with parchment paper or lightly grease it. Transfer the peanut butter mixture into the pan and press evenly with your hands or a spatula to create a smooth surface.
Step 5: Chill Until Set
Place the pan in the refrigerator for at least one hour to firm up. This allows the bars to hold their shape and makes them easier to cut.
Step 6: Cut and Serve
Once chilled, remove from the pan and slice into bars or squares. Serve immediately or keep refrigerated until ready to enjoy.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Keep your leftover Easy Peanut Butter Bars fresh by storing them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week.
Freezing
These bars freeze beautifully! Place them in a freezer-safe container or wrap individually in plastic wrap and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w in the refrigerator before serving.
Reheating
No need for reheating since these bars are best enjoyed chilled or at room temperature, which preserves their creamy, firm texture perfectly.

Easy Peanut Butter Bars
- Total Time: 1 hour 10 minutes (includes chilling time)
- Yield: 12 bars 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
Easy Peanut Butter Bars are a no-bake, quick-to-prepare sweet treat that combines creamy peanut butter, powdered sugar, and butter for a rich, chewy texture. Perfect for snacking, sharing, or a last-minute dessert, these bars require no oven and use simple pantry staples. Customizable with optional add-ins like chocolate chips or nuts, they deliver satisfying flavor in minutes.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 cup creamy or chunky peanut butter
- 2 cups powdered sugar
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Optional Mix-ins
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ips (optional)
- 1/2 cup chopped nuts (optional)
- 1/2 cup toasted oats or crispy rice cereal (optional)
- 1 scoop protein powder (optional)
Instructions
- Prepare the Peanut Butter Mixture: Start by softening the butter in a mixing bowl, then add the peanut butter and vanilla extract. Stir until smooth and creamy, ensuring everything is well combined for the best texture.
- Incorporate the Powdered Sugar: Gradually mix in the powdered sugar. Use a spatula or wooden spoon to combine, pressing firmly to create a thick, dough-like consistency. This mixture should become pliable but not crumbly.
- Add Optional Mix-Ins: If you want extra flavor or texture, fold in chocolate chips, nuts, or crunchy cereal now. These additions make each bite a little more exciting.
- Press Into a Pan: Line a square baking dish with parchment paper or lightly grease it. Transfer the peanut butter mixture into the pan and press evenly with your hands or a spatula to create a smooth surface.
- Chill Until Set: Place the pan in the refrigerator for at least one hour to firm up. This allows the bars to hold their shape and makes them easier to cut.
- Cut and Serve: Once chilled, remove from the pan and slice into bars or squares. Serve immediately or keep refrigerated until ready to enjoy.
